º Tool º/git

[github 에러] The requested URL returned error: 403 (fatal: unable to access)

Poony 2023. 10. 6. 03:24

403오류는 해당 레포지토리 주소에 접근 권한이 없을 경우 발생한다고 한다.

해결하기위해서는 재인증이 필요하다. 따라서 Remote URL을 변경해주어야 한다.

다음과같은 코드를 해당 레포지토리의 git bash 등에 입력하여 해결할 수 있다.

 

git remote set-url origin https://YOURUSERNAME@github.com/USERNAME/REPOSITORY.git

 

입력하고 테스트용 commit과 push를 날려보니
깃허브에 로그인하라는 창이 떴고,
새로 발급했던 토큰 키를 입력하고나니 오류가 해결되었다.

bash에서 push했을 때와 소스트리에서 push했을 때 전부 문제 없었다.

 

git remote set-url {remote git 주소 복사}

git remote set-url https://github.com/깃허브계정이름/레포이름